Thanks to all the brilliant advice on this forum I have managed a successful appeal against an outrageous parking fine issued by Armtrac (part of KBT) in Falmouth.
The appeal went to POPLA and was upheld as the £100 was not deemed a genuine pre estimate of loss.
Thanks to all who have contributed to the newbies FAQ threads and similar, this forum is a great resource against the bullying tactics of these cowboy parking companies. I hope as many people as possible who are issued these charges find their way here and are not intimidated into paying such large sums for such small offences.
